About this service

A tin roof refers to a traditional metal covering often found on older homes or barns. While durable, these roofs can develop rust spots or loose seams over time, which allows moisture to seep underneath. If you hear rattling during wind or see signs of oxidation, it is time for an inspection. Repairing these involves securing fasteners and applying specialized coatings to stop further decay. What are the benefits of metal roofing in Rancho Cucamonga?

Metal roofing offers exceptional longevity and durability, making it an excellent choice for the climate in Rancho Cucamonga. Its resistance to high winds and intense sun is a significant advantage. Metal roofs are also highly reflective, which can contribute to energy efficiency, a key consideration for many homeowners. They require less maintenance over their lifespan compared to other materials. Consider a metal roof for lasting protection.

When should I consider using a roof sealant?

Roof sealant is best applied to address minor cracks, seams, or flashing issues before they escalate into larger leaks. It acts as a protective barrier against water intrusion, extending the life of your existing roof. Regular inspections are recommended to identify areas where sealant might be beneficial. Applying sealant can be a cost-effective way to prevent more extensive damage. It's a proactive measure for maintaining roof integrity.

How do I know if my roof in Rancho Cucamonga needs repair?

Look for common signs like missing or damaged shingles, water stains on ceilings or walls, and granule loss in your gutters, which are often visible after heavy rain or wind events in Rancho Cucamonga. Sagging areas of the roof deck are also a critical indicator of underlying structural issues. If you notice increased energy bills or find yourself constantly adjusting your thermostat, your roof's insulation or integrity might be compromised. Don't ignore these warning signs; they often precede more severe problems. A thorough inspection can pinpoint the exact nature of the issue.

Are rubber roofing materials suitable for my home?

Rubber roofing, often in the form of EPDM or TPO membranes, is particularly well-suited for low-slope or flat roofs, common in certain architectural styles found throughout the area. It provides excellent waterproofing capabilities and is known for its resilience against extreme temperatures. This material is a practical choice for areas where water pooling could be a concern. Its flexibility allows it to expand and contract without cracking. It's a reliable option for specific roof designs.

What impact does roof insulation have on my energy bills?

Proper roof insulation is critical for maintaining consistent indoor temperatures, significantly reducing your reliance on HVAC systems in Rancho Cucamonga. Adequate insulation prevents heat transfer, keeping your home cooler in the summer and warmer in the winter. This directly translates to lower energy consumption and, consequently, reduced utility bills. It also helps prevent ice dams in colder months, though less common here. Investing in good insulation offers long-term savings.
